Located just north of Downtown San Diego, Sorrento Valley is a charming neighbourhood with excellent access to the surrounding region, including a multitude of natural spaces. The district is bordered by the Los Peñasquitos Canyon Preserve to the north, Camino Santa Fe to the east and Miramar Road to the south, and is well-connected to the wider state area via the Coaster commuter train and the Amtrak Pacific Surfliner. The area is home to numerous IT, high tech and biotech companies, such as Optimer Pharmaceuticals, Texas Instruments, T-Mobile and PwC. Moreover, the Federal Bureau of Investigation moved into this locale in 2013, while Dexcom, Accelrys and Qualcomm are also headquartered in this locale.
